Dagmara Domińczyk
Summary
Dagmara Domińczyk is a human[1]. Her place of birth was Kielce[2]. She was born on July 17, 1976[3]. She worked as a stage actor[4], film actor[5], television actor[6], voice actor[7], and writer[8].
